Elliot Unisex
Name Meaning & Origin Pronunciation: EL-ee-it /ˈɛl.i.ət/
Origin: Hebrew; English
Meaning: Hebrew: God is my Lord; English: The Lord is my God
Historical & Cultural Background
The name Elliot has its roots in the Hebrew name Eliyahu, meaning "my God is Yahweh." This name was adapted into Greek as Elias and subsequently into Latin as Elias as well. The name made its way into Old French as Élie, which was then anglicized to Elliot in Middle English.
The transition into English occurred around the 12th century, influenced by the Norman Conquest, which brought many Old French names into the English language. The spelling variations, including Elliott, emerged later, reflecting different regional pronunciations and preferences.
Historically, the name Elliot has been borne by several notable figures. One of the most significant is the biblical prophet Elijah, whose story is recounted in the Hebrew Bible and the Christian Old Testament.
His narrative, particularly in the context of the King James Bible published in 1611, has contributed to the name's enduring presence in Christian tradition. Additionally, the name has been associated with various saints, particularly Saint Elias, who is venerated in both Eastern and Western Christian traditions.
Culturally, the name Elliot has been linked to themes of strength and divine connection, resonating with its original meaning. It has appeared in various literary works and historical texts, further embedding it in cultural consciousness.
The name's adaptability has allowed it to maintain relevance across different eras, with diminutive forms like Eli emerging in various contexts. U.S. Historical Usage
The name Elliot was first seen in the United States in 1880.
Elliot has ranked as high as #257 nationally, which occurred in 2022, and has been most popular in New York, California, Texas, Illinois, and Pennsylvania.
In the past 5 years the name Elliot has been trending up compared to the previous 5 years.
